Summary of Key Insights
Planit Pro: Photo Planner is a highly regarded app for landscape, travel, nature, and astrophotography planning. Users praise its comprehensive features, accuracy, and the developer's responsiveness. However, recurring issues include app crashes, difficulties with the user interface, and concerns about pricing and feature access. The overall sentiment is overwhelmingly positive, with a significant majority of users giving the app a 5-star rating. The app effectively combines multiple tools into one, saving photographers time and effort.
Quantitative Metrics:
- Overall Rating: High (based on review distribution)
- 5-Star Reviews: 77%
- 4-Star Reviews: 4%
- 3-Star Reviews: 4%
- 2-Star Reviews: 6%
- 1-Star Reviews: 9%
Key Strengths: Comprehensive features, accuracy, VR mode, developer responsiveness, offline functionality.
Key Weaknesses: App crashes, UI complexity, pricing concerns, feature access issues, map resolution in certain regions.

Key User Pain Points
- App Crashes: Several users reported frequent app crashes, particularly after updates or when moving the app to an SD card, significantly hindering usability.
- UI Complexity: Many users find the UI overwhelming and confusing, requiring significant effort to learn.
- Pricing and Feature Access: Some users complained about features that were previously free now requiring payment, feeling it was "greedy". There are also issues with purchasing or accessing paid features.
- Map Resolution Issues: Users in South Korea reported extremely poor satellite layer resolution.
- Data Loss: Some users reported losing their saved plans and markers after updates.
- Password Reset Issues: Some users are not receiving password reset emails.
- Storage Access Issues: Some users are experiencing issues with the app accessing the phone's storage, preventing them from using certain features like the viewfinder picture feature or downloading elevation files.
- Forced Updates: Users find forced update notifications annoying, especially when they interrupt the app's use.
Frequently Requested Features
- Eclipse Prediction: A feature for predicting sun and moon eclipses.
- PC/Desktop Version: A desktop version of the app.
- Weather Conditions: Integration of weather conditions, including astronomical and stargazing weather.
- GoPro Settings: Integration with GoPro settings.
- Improved Street View Integration: Full functionality in Street View with overlays.
- Syncing with External Calendar: Ability to sync plans with external calendars.
- Indicator for Active Task: A clear indicator of the task currently being worked on.
- Building Models in VR View: Inclusion of 3D models of buildings in the VR view.
Strengths and Positive Aspects
- Comprehensive Features: Users appreciate the wide range of features available for planning various types of photography.
- Accuracy: The app is praised for its accurate predictions of celestial events and location data.
- VR Mode: The VR mode is a standout feature, allowing users to preview scenes with terrain data and plan shots remotely.
- Developer Responsiveness: Many users commend the developer's responsiveness to questions and feedback.
- Offline Functionality: The ability to use the app offline is highly valued, especially when exploring remote locations.
- Value for Money: Despite some pricing concerns, many users feel the app offers excellent value for its price.
- Comparison to Alternatives: Some users explicitly state Planit Pro is superior to other similar apps like PhotoPills.
